Transaction 102540356722edb2e6838e95321dd093c44f2219139e546e2b12aa84ba433738

1 Input
2 Outputs
  • 102540356722edb2e6838e95321dd093c44f2219139e546e2b12aa84ba433738:0
  • value  4829657
    address  1sNAucV7gSh2YHqLkQTS9n7EwAhtMe1oM
  • 102540356722edb2e6838e95321dd093c44f2219139e546e2b12aa84ba433738:1
  • value  361127
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n